Introduction
The Zonar 2020 is an Android-based tablet focused on providing a rugged device with
all-in-one technology that drivers can use to perform inspections, navigate routes, view
workflows, tasks, send and receive messages, maintain electronic HOS records and
receive driving feedback. Also, drivers and their managers can easily access these
records through Zonar’s servers in order to improve efficiency and safety across their
projects. In addition, the 2020 can scale and grow to develop additional applications that
can be applicable to any business or business needs of our customers.

2020 First-time boot up Guide
The first time the 2020 is booted up, the device performs a series of internal checks and tests to
ensure that it is ready for use. The 2020 checks for and loads the Organization and Asset
Profiles. Organization Profiles contain all of the information associated with the organization
including the settings and loaded applications in their 2020s. Asset Profiles contain all of the
information on the vehicles or assets that the 2020 will interact with.
Typically, a technician performs this first-time boot up, and they can perform any necessary
fixes as well as accept the license agreements of the 2020 and Navigation software.
1) Technician powers on 2020
2) The 2020 checks for a cellular connection
a. If no cellular connection is found, 2020 checks for existing profiles in cache
b. If no profiles are found, error message is displayed and the user is sent back
3) Once connected, the 2020 sends Org/Asset ping with the current version and date
a. If the version does not match what is found on the server, they are wirelessly
retrieved and updated in the cache
4) Once the most current profiles are loaded, the 2020 checks for Navigation in the profile
a. If Navigation is found, a warning message is displayed, requiring the user to
accept it before moving on to the next step
5) The technician is presented with and accepts the License Agreements
6) Users may log in normally

2020 Driver ID/PIN setup in GTC
In order to access the 2020 tablet and its applications, drivers must prove a Driver ID and PIN.
These features are bundled in with Zonar’s Ground Traffic Control system. In order to fully log in,
the 2020 must have the following:
 Driver ID
In the GTC, the Driver ID is referred to as the Zonar Tag Number
 PIN
 Set Home location
If these are not set when they attempt to use it, the driver cannot log in to the 2020 or use any of
its tools or applications.
Please refer to the Zonar GTC manual for full details on setting up and maintaining GTC login
information.

2020 Self-Check Guide
The 2020 performs a self-check every time it is powered on. In addition, the driver may use the
Self-Check option to run the test as well through the ZLogs application. Normally, this is done
when the 2020 loses its wireless signal and the 2020 prompts the user to run the self-test as
soon as the signal is re-acquired and the unit is back online.
1) Check for enabled HOS
2) Test for connection to Zonar V2J/V3
3) GPS Unit tests
a. Memory check
i. If available memory is equal to or greater than 95%, the 2020 reports a
failure
1. On failure, the driver must prepare a paper log
b. Voltage check
i. If the CMV battery voltage is equal to or greater than 11.8 volts, the 2020
reports a failure
1. On failure, the driver must prepare a paper log
c. Clock check
i. If the time does not update successfully, the 2020 reports a failure
1. On failure, the driver must prepare a paper log
d. GPS check
i. If no latitude/longitude data is returned, the 2020 reports a failure
1. On failure, the driver is notified to verify location at next stop
a. See ZLogs application for more information
e. Odometer value
i. If ECM odometer mileage cannot be found, the 2020 reports a failure.
1. On failure, driver is prompted to enter mileage at next duty status
change
a. See ZLogs application for more information
4) 2020 Unit Tests
Zonar 2020 User’s Guide
17
a. 2020 Memory
i. If available memory is equal to or greater than 95%, the 2020 reports a
failure
b. 2020 Battery
i. If remaining battery is less than 10%, the 2020 reports a failure
5) GPS Unit
a. If no response is found, test is logged as a failure
b. If there is a response, a self-test analysis is performed, logging success or failure

2020 Sleep Mode
When the 2020 is undocked, or docked on a vehicle without power, the device times out and
enters a sleep mode after a certain period of time to improve driver management and device
security. By default, this period is 2 minutes, but this may be adjusted to 30 seconds, 1 minute,
10 minutes or 30 minutes.
To exit from sleep mode, a user presses the Power button.
When coming out of sleep mode, a user must choose which driver to log in as, and enter the
appropriate PIN.
Unlock screen
Additionally, the 2020 automatically logs a driver off after a set period of inactive time. By default,
the time is 8 days, but the value be adjusted from 0 to 30 days.

Updating Applications
In order to maintain the most up-to-date versions of installed applications, the 2020
automatically checks for and, if able, downloads updates to loaded applications. While each
2020’s load of installed applications may vary, the process used to update them remains the
same between applications.
1) Application versions on the 2020 are compared to the versions on the manifest
a. If the application versions match, the process ends successfully
2) If necessary updates are found, the 2020 checks for WiFi connectivity
3) If WiFi connectivity is found:
a. 2020 notifies the user of pending updates and asks to proceed with the download
i. If the approval is given to proceed, the 2020 downloads the updates
immediately
ii. If the user does not allow the download, and the application is non-critical,
the 2020 disables the application until it is fully updated
iii. If it is a critical application, the application is disabled until updated
1. NOTE: If the update is smaller than 1mb in size, the 2020
downloads and installs the update via cellular network if no WiFi
connection is available
b. Once downloaded, applications are installed and applied automatically
4) If WiFi connectivity cannot be found:
a. 2020 notifies the user of pending updates available for download
b. If it is a non-critical update, the application is disabled until fully updated.
c. If it is a critical application, it is disabled until updated
i. NOTE: If the update is smaller than 1mb in size, the 2020 downloads and
applies the update over cellular signal if no WiFi connection is available
5) Once all application versions are updated, the user may use their applications, unless
disabled by the 2020 for uninstalled updates

Docking Station
The 2020 docking station fits into the vehicle and serves as a home for the tablet. From the
dock, the 2020 tablet is charged and works to both charge the tablet while not in use, but also
as a wireless communication hub.
2020 Docking Station (with docked 2020)
When docked, information obtained during an EVIR scan wirelessly transmits to Zonar’s
backend server for collection and analysis.

Caring for the 2020
 Avoid dropping the 2020 and operating it in high-shock and high-vibration environments
 Do not expose the 2020 to water
Contact with water can cause the 2020 to malfunction
 Do not store the 2020 where prolonged exposure to extreme temperatures can occur
Prolonged exposure can permanently damage the 2020
 Never use a hard or sharp object to operate the 2020 touchscreen
Doing so may damage the touchscreen and leave it nonfunctional
Cleaning the 2020
Notice: Avoid chemical cleaners and solvents that can damage plastic components.
1. Clean the outer casing of the 2020 (not the touchscreen) using a cloth dampened with a
mild detergent solution
2. Wipe the device dry with a clean, dry cloth
Cleaning the Touchscreen
Zonar 2020 User’s Guide
35
1. Use a soft, clean, lint-free cloth
2. If necessary, use water, isopropyl alcohol or eyeglass lens cleaner
3. Apply the liquid to the cloth
4. Gently wipe the 2020 screen with the cloth

My device is not charging in my vehicle.
 Ensure the 2020 tablet is properly loaded into the docking station
 Check the fuse in the V2J/V3
 Re-seat the 2020 in the docking station
 The 2020 can only charge between 32° F and 113° F (between 0° C and 45° C)
If the temperature is outside of this range, it may not charge properly

Lithium-Ion Battery Warning
This product contains a lithium-ion battery. To prevent the possibility of personal injury or
product damage caused by battery exposure to extreme heat, remove the device from the
vehicle when exiting or store it out of direct sunlight.
Distracted Driving Warning
Do not use this device while the vehicle is in motion or in any other driving situation. Using the
device while driving can create dangerous situations where the driver may not be focused on
the road or task at hand.
